威纶通触摸屏脚本编写全攻略是一份详尽的指导材料,旨在帮助用户掌握威纶通触摸屏的脚本编写技巧。该攻略可能涵盖了脚本编写的基础知识、常用指令和函数、编写流程、调试技巧以及实际应用案例等内容。通过学习这份攻略,用户可以更加高效地利用威纶通触摸屏进行自动化控制和人机交互设计,提升设备的智能化水平和用户体验。
本文目录导读:
本文详细介绍了如何在威纶通触摸屏上编写高效、可靠的脚本,涵盖了脚本编写的基础知识、常用指令、实例解析以及优化建议,通过本文的学习,读者将能够掌握威纶通触摸屏脚本编写的核心技巧,提升设备的交互性和智能化水平。
威纶通触摸屏作为工业自动化领域的重要组件,其脚本编写功能为设备的灵活控制和高效交互提供了有力支持,随着技术的不断发展,脚本编写已成为触摸屏应用开发中不可或缺的一部分,本文将深入探讨威纶通触摸屏脚本编写的各个方面,帮助读者掌握这一重要技能。
脚本编写基础
1、脚本环境搭建
在编写威纶通触摸屏脚本之前,首先需要搭建好脚本环境,这包括安装必要的软件工具(如EB8000等)、配置触摸屏参数以及建立与PLC或其他控制设备的通信连接。
2、脚本语言选择
威纶通触摸屏支持多种脚本语言,如VBScript、JavaScript等,根据具体需求选择合适的脚本语言,可以大大提高脚本的编写效率和执行性能。
3、变量与函数
在脚本编写中,变量和函数是不可或缺的元素,合理使用变量可以存储和传递数据,而函数则可以实现特定的功能或操作,了解并掌握变量和函数的定义、调用及作用域等基本概念,是编写高效脚本的基础。
常用指令解析
1、屏幕切换指令
屏幕切换是触摸屏应用中常见的操作之一,通过编写脚本,可以实现不同屏幕之间的灵活切换,常用的屏幕切换指令包括“SetScreen”等,它们可以根据条件判断或用户操作来触发屏幕切换。
2、数据读写指令
在触摸屏与PLC或其他控制设备之间传输数据时,需要使用数据读写指令,这些指令可以读取PLC寄存器中的数据,并将其显示在触摸屏上;也可以将触摸屏上的数据写入PLC寄存器,以实现设备的控制。
3、事件处理指令
触摸屏上的各种事件(如按钮点击、滑动等)需要通过事件处理指令来响应,这些指令可以捕捉事件并触发相应的操作,如显示提示信息、执行特定功能等。
实例解析
1、简单按钮点击事件
假设我们需要在触摸屏上设置一个按钮,当按钮被点击时,显示一条提示信息,这可以通过编写以下脚本实现:
Sub Button_Click() MsgBox "按钮已被点击!" End Sub
将上述脚本绑定到按钮的点击事件中,即可实现所需功能。
2、数据读取与显示
以下是一个从PLC读取数据并在触摸屏上显示的脚本示例:
Dim data data = ReadPLCRegister("D100") ' 假设D100是PLC中的一个寄存器 HMI_Text.Text = data ' 将读取到的数据显示在触摸屏上的文本框中
通过该脚本,我们可以实现PLC与触摸屏之间的数据交互。
优化建议
1、代码优化
在编写脚本时,应注重代码的优化,避免冗余代码、合理使用变量和函数、减少不必要的循环和判断等,可以提高脚本的执行效率和可读性。
2、错误处理
在脚本中添加错误处理机制,可以捕获并处理可能出现的错误情况,避免程序崩溃或异常行为,常用的错误处理方法包括使用“On Error Resume Next”语句等。
3、性能监控
对于复杂的触摸屏应用,性能监控是确保系统稳定运行的重要手段,通过监控脚本的执行时间、内存占用等指标,可以及时发现并解决性能瓶颈问题。
威纶通触摸屏脚本编写是一项复杂而重要的任务,通过掌握基础知识、熟悉常用指令、解析实例以及注重优化建议,我们可以编写出高效、可靠的脚本,为设备的交互性和智能化水平提供有力支持,希望本文能为读者在威纶通触摸屏脚本编写方面提供有益的参考和帮助。